The thing is you could justify it if he was a inside-outside mid or inside mid - but he purely is an outside mid. A 30 possession game might be okay with that terrible kicking if you split those possessions 50-50 contested/uncontested. But the fact is that three quarters of his touches are uncontested so his kicking needs to be much better because once you win the ball uncontested the kicking is the entire part of the possession.
 
Those who reckon over the last two weeks that teams are setting up to shut us down, you're right. Watch them congest the middle of the ground. Forces us to work the boundaries where we dont have the height or marking targets (handballing is our game).

We need to figure this one out. We are now dangerous enough of a side that other teams are willing to sacrifice their natural game plan to shut ours down. Gotta find a way to work the boundary or be good enough to work handballs through the middle.
